Types of Hall Public Records

Hall Public Records encompass a wide range of documents and information. Some of the most commonly requested records include:

  • Property Records: These records provide information on property ownership, property values, and property taxes.
  • Court Records: These records include information on civil and criminal cases, as well as court proceedings and decisions.
  • Vital Records: These records include birth certificates, death certificates, marriage licenses, and divorce decrees.
  • Business Records: These records include information on local businesses, such as business licenses and permits.
